• 技术文章 >Python技术 >Python基础教程

    python函数实参的四种类型

    小妮浅浅小妮浅浅2021-09-11 11:10:20原创156

    1、位置实参,实参与形参的位置依次对应。

    func01(1, 2, 3, 4)

    2、序列实参,将序列拆分后按顺序与形参进行对应。

    itrable_in = 1, 2, 3, 4 # 传入的是序列中的元素。
    func01(*itrable_in)  # python的解释器在遇到星号时会告诉CPU接下来的变量内的元素是函数参数。

    3、关键字实参,实参根据形参的名字进行对应。

    func01(p2=2, p1=1, p4=4, p3=3)

    4、字典实参,将字典拆分后按名称与形参进行对应。

    dict_in = {'p1': 1, 'p2': 2, 'p3': 3, 'p4': 4}
    func01(**dict_in)

    以上就是python函数实参的四种类型,希望对大家有所帮助。更多Python学习指路:python基础教程

    专题推荐:python 函数 实参
    品易云
    上一篇:python函数中的形参有几种 下一篇:python变量名的查找方法

    相关文章推荐

    • python不同类型的对象特点• python有哪些数组叠加函数• python数组分割的函数• python中INF值的介绍• Python requests如何发送请求• python requests读取服务器响应• python requests响应内容的三种方法• python requests发送不同类型的数据• python requests检测响应状态码• python requests重定向的操作• python requests的超时使用• python捕获异常的原因• python创建平衡二叉树的方法• python如何配置文件路径• python字典的底层原理• python函数中的形参有几种

    全部评论我要评论

    © 2021 Python学习网 苏ICP备2021003149号-1

  • 取消发布评论
  • 

    Python学习网